Interfaith Outreach of SanCap Announces Shared Scholar Program
Interfaith Outreach of Sancap is pleased to announce the 2026 Shared Scholar Program, featuring renowned author, activist, and faith-based thought leader Brian D. McLaren. His public lecture, titled “Where Faith-Inspired Action Could Take Us,” will take place on Sunday, February 15, 2026, at 3:00 PM in the Sanctuary of Sanibel Congregational United Church of Christ, 2050 Periwinkle Way. Over 500 In Attendance At The Charitable Foundation Volunteer Expo
Left: Kathy Knoblauch Right: Nancy Roach On Wednesday January 28th, the Captiva Chapel by the Sea hosted one of 59 tables at the Sanibel Community House to connect with potential attendees for our Chapel. Over 500 people participated. Hosting our table were Board President, Kathy Knoblauch & Nancy Roach. The event was sponsored by the Charitable Foundation of the Islands (CFI). Chip Roach. former CFI Board Chair, also helped out at the Chapel table. Chip & Nancy Roach

UPCOMING VISIT BY NEW MINISTER
The Chapel Board has selected our next minister, the Rev. Dr. Jim Miller, and his wife, Diane, to lead our Chapel for the next three years. Jim and Diane will be with us for worship on January 25 and will be available to meet attendees following the service. Dr. Miller is the retired pastor of the First Presbyterian Church of Tulsa, Oklahoma. They will begin their ministry term with us in November of 2026.

Sunday, November 30, 2025 Service - The First Sunday of Advent
84 people attended. Several dozen stayed after hospitality to help with the lights & Christmas Tree. First time helpers were 3 Captiva Co. personnel and 4 Boy Scouts from local Troop 1740 Sanibel.
